List of all items
Structs
- MemberlistOptions
- NodeResponse
- Options
- QueryParam
- QueryResponse
- Serf
- UnknownRecordType
- coordinate::Coordinate
- coordinate::CoordinateClient
- coordinate::CoordinateClientStats
- coordinate::CoordinateOptions
- delegate::CompositeDelegate
- delegate::DefaultMergeDelegate
- delegate::LpeTransfromDelegate
- delegate::NoopReconnectDelegate
- error::JoinError
- error::RelayError
- event::EventProducer
- event::EventSubscriber
- event::MemberEvent
- event::QueryEvent
- event::RecvError
- key_manager::KeyManager
- key_manager::KeyRequestOptions
- key_manager::KeyResponse
- types::JoinMessage
- types::KeyRequestMessage
- types::KeyRequestOptions
- types::KeyResponse
- types::KeyResponseMessage
- types::LamportClock
- types::LamportTime
- types::LeaveMessage
- types::Member
- types::Node
- types::NodeAddress
- types::NodeId
- types::PushPullMessage
- types::PushPullMessageRef
- types::QueryFlag
- types::QueryMessage
- types::QueryResponseMessage
- types::Tags
- types::UnknownDelegateVersion
- types::UnknownFilterType
- types::UnknownMemberStatus
- types::UnknownMemberlistDelegateVersion
- types::UnknownMemberlistProtocolVersion
- types::UnknownMessageType
- types::UnknownProtocolVersion
- types::UserEvent
- types::UserEventMessage
- types::UserEvents
Enums
- SerfState
- SnapshotError
- coordinate::CoordinateError
- coordinate::CoordinateTransformError
- delegate::LpeTransformError
- error::Error
- error::MemberlistError
- error::SerfDelegateError
- error::SerfError
- error::SnapshotError
- event::Event
- event::MemberEventType
- event::TryRecvError
- types::DelegateVersion
- types::Filter
- types::FilterTransformError
- types::FilterType
- types::JoinMessageTransformError
- types::KeyResponseMessageTransformError
- types::LamportTimeTransformError
- types::LeaveMessageTransformError
- types::MemberStatus
- types::MemberTransformError
- types::MemberlistDelegateVersion
- types::MemberlistProtocolVersion
- types::MessageType
- types::NodeAddressError
- types::NodeIdTransformError
- types::NodeTransformError
- types::OptionSecretKeyTransformError
- types::ProtocolVersion
- types::PushPullMessageTransformError
- types::QueryMessageTransformError
- types::QueryResponseMessageTransformError
- types::SerfMessage
- types::SerfMessageRef
- types::SerfMessageTransformError
- types::TagsTransformError
- types::UserEventMessageTransformError
- types::UserEventTransformError
- types::UserEventsTransformError
Traits
- delegate::Delegate
- delegate::MergeDelegate
- delegate::ReconnectDelegate
- delegate::TransformDelegate
- types::AsMessageRef
- types::Encodable
- types::Transformable
Macros
Functions
- tests::delegate::delegate_local_state
- tests::delegate::delegate_merge_remote_state
- tests::delegate::delegate_nodemeta
- tests::delegate::delegate_nodemeta_panic
- tests::delegate::serf_ping_delegate_rogue_coordinate
- tests::delegate::serf_ping_delegate_versioning
- tests::estimate_max_keys_in_list_key_response_factor
- tests::event::default_query
- tests::event::query_old_message
- tests::event::query_params_encode_filters
- tests::event::query_same_clock
- tests::event::serf_event_user
- tests::event::serf_event_user_size_limit
- tests::event::serf_events_failed
- tests::event::serf_events_join
- tests::event::serf_events_leave
- tests::event::serf_events_leave_avoid_infinite_rebroadcast
- tests::event::serf_query
- tests::event::serf_query_deduplicate
- tests::event::serf_query_filter
- tests::event::serf_query_size_limit
- tests::event::serf_query_size_limit_increased
- tests::event::serf_remove_failed_events_leave
- tests::event::should_process
- tests::event::user_event_old_message
- tests::event::user_event_same_clock
- tests::initialize_tests_tracing
- tests::join::join_intent_buffer_early
- tests::join::join_intent_newer
- tests::join::join_intent_old_message
- tests::join::join_intent_reset_leaving
- tests::join::join_leave_ltime
- tests::join::join_pending_intent
- tests::join::join_pending_intents
- tests::join::serf_join_cancel
- tests::join::serf_join_ignore_old
- tests::join::serf_join_leave
- tests::join::serf_join_leave_join
- tests::key_list_key_response_with_correct_size
- tests::leave::leave_intent_buffer_early
- tests::leave::leave_intent_newer
- tests::leave::leave_intent_old_message
- tests::leave::serf_force_leave_failed
- tests::leave::serf_force_leave_leaving
- tests::leave::serf_force_leave_left
- tests::leave::serf_leave_rejoin_different_role
- tests::leave::serf_leave_snapshot_recovery
- tests::next_socket_addr_v4
- tests::next_socket_addr_v6
- tests::queries_conflict_same_name
- tests::queries_pass_through
- tests::queries_ping
- tests::reap::serf_reap
- tests::reap::serf_reap_handler
- tests::reap::serf_reap_handler_shutdown
- tests::reconnect::serf_per_node_reconnect_timeout
- tests::reconnect::serf_reconnect
- tests::reconnect::serf_reconnect_same_ip
- tests::remove::serf_remove_failed_node
- tests::remove::serf_remove_failed_node_ourself
- tests::remove::serf_remove_failed_node_prune
- tests::run
- tests::serf_coordinates
- tests::serf_get_queue_max
- tests::serf_local_member
- tests::serf_name_resolution
- tests::serf_num_nodes
- tests::serf_role
- tests::serf_set_tags
- tests::serf_state
- tests::serf_stats
- tests::serf_update
- tests::serf_write_keyring_file
- tests::snapshot::serf_snapshot_recovery
- tests::snapshot::snapshoter
- tests::snapshot::snapshoter_force_compact
- tests::snapshot::snapshoter_leave
- tests::snapshot::snapshoter_leave_rejoin